  • I purchased the Kogan 30" Curved 21:9 Ultrawide 75Hz FreeSync Gaming Monitor (2560 x 1080)
    https://help.kogan.com/hc/article_attachments/360019535453/K…

    Great price $289.00 - Can't comment as to whether 75mhz is awesome or not, but 'Kingdom Come' plays well.

    As for the claim of Bezel-less Display - Horse Sh|t…

    I currently have a Support ticket open due to my Bezel-Less Display actually having a 10+mm bezel on the left, top and right of the display - Hardley Bezel-less.

    Kogan Support has claimed its not a Hardware Fault or Manufacturing defect and have so far offered me $30 compensation. I'm holding out as I want a 30" Bezel-Less display, as was advertised, paid for and expected.

    I've heard from another owner of the same monitor who has experienced exactly the same issue.

    Just sayin, if Bezel-Less display is important to you, Kogan Monitors may not be the best way to go…
